My client is a rapidly expanding CF boutique and they are now looking to recruit a Corporate Finance Manager / Director to join the growing team in their Manchester office. This is a great opportunity to manage and grow a team whilst being hands-on providing a range of advisory services to corporates and private equity funds.
We are looking for ACA qualified CF professionals with demonstrable experience in managing the full life cycle of deals. Clear career prospects are on offer as you will be tasked with growing the team as the firm scales. Interviews are ongoing so apply now.

How to prepare for a job interview at WH Finance Ltd
✨Know Your Numbers
As a Corporate Finance Manager or Director, you’ll need to be on top of your financial game. Brush up on key financial metrics and deal structures relevant to the role. Be prepared to discuss past deals you've managed and how you added value.
✨Showcase Leadership Skills
Since this role involves managing and growing a team, highlight your leadership experience. Think of specific examples where you’ve successfully led a team through a challenging project or mentored junior staff. This will show that you’re not just a finance whiz but also a great leader.
✨Understand the Firm's Vision
Research the company’s growth strategy and recent deals they’ve completed. This will help you align your answers with their goals during the interview. Showing that you understand their vision will demonstrate your genuine interest in the role.
✨Prepare Thoughtful Questions
Interviews are a two-way street, so prepare insightful questions about the firm’s culture, team dynamics, and future projects.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
